The Birth of Casinos
To understand the world of casinos, one must first delve into their history. The earliest known casino was the Ridotto, a gaming club established in 1638 in Venice, Italy. This exclusive club catered to the city’s upper class, offering games like baccarat and roulette. However, it wasn’t until the mid-19th century that casinos began to spread across Europe and eventually made their way to the United States.
The Golden Age of Casinos
By the early 20th century, casinos had become a staple in Las Vegas, Nevada. The construction of the Flamingo Hotel in 1946 marked the beginning of a new era for casino entertainment. This luxury resort was founded by notorious gangster Bugsy Siegel and offered high-end gaming, fine dining, and live music to its guests.
The 1950s and ’60s are often referred to as the "Golden Age" of casinos. During this time, iconic establishments like the Sands Hotel and Casino (where Frank Sinatra got his start) and Caesars Palace rose to prominence. These early casinos set the stage for modern entertainment complexes by offering a variety of gaming options, lavish amenities, and world-class performances.
Modern Casinos: An Evolution in Entertainment
Fast-forward to today, and casinos have transformed into immersive destinations that cater to diverse tastes and preferences. Modern casinos now offer an unparalleled range of activities, from high-stakes poker rooms and electronic gaming areas to live music venues, comedy clubs, and even celebrity-chef restaurants.
One notable example is the Cosmopolitan Hotel and Casino in Las Vegas, which boasts a rooftop pool, a 3,200-seat theater for concerts and productions, and over 100 dining options. Similarly, the MGM Grand has expanded its offerings with a sprawling entertainment complex featuring Cirque du Soleil shows, a massive aquarium, and an escape room.
Gaming Innovations
Casinos have also made significant strides in gaming innovations, adapting to changing player preferences and technological advancements. Some of the most popular modern games include:
- Video Poker : A digital twist on traditional poker, allowing players to make strategic decisions at their own pace.
- Slot Machines with Progressive Jackpots : Linked machines that pool funds from multiple locations, offering massive prizes for lucky winners.
- Live Dealer Games : Real-time gaming experiences featuring human dealers and virtual tables.
